Q3 Planning Note — Heads of Department

As discussed at the Marlowe offsite, we will raise pricing for legacy Ferncrest subscribers beginning next quarter. Roughly 1,400 accounts remain on pre-2019 terms, priced on average 22% below current list. The increase will be phased: notice letters first, then a 60-day grace window, with retention offers reserved for the top tier. Support should expect elevated ticket volume; Dana Wexler is coordinating scripts. Please review the sensitivities below before circulating anything beyond this group.

management briefing: The renewal with Zoraelax Group closes at $10 million a year, 15 percent below the last contract. Project Ralael slips by six weeks because of the audit delay.

Subject: Ledgerbase cut-over complete

Cut-over done at 02:10. Schema migrations ran via Driftgate's dual-write path; zero downtime confirmed. Old tables stay read-only for 72 hours, then drop. Rollback window closes Thursday. Watch replication lag on the orders shard — anything over 5s, page me. No customer impact reported.

For reference during your shift, the active service configuration is as follows.

service settings:
PRAIX_LOG_LEVEL=error
PRAIX_METRICS_HOST=metrics.praix.qorvelcorp.corp
PRAIX_POOL_SIZE=16

## Authentication

Fonts vendored from the Marrowtype foundry are fetched at build time by the Driftgate pipeline, not at runtime. The fetch step authenticates against our internal font mirror; the foundry's upstream is never contacted from CI. On-call: if the font-sync job fails, it is almost always an expired credential, not a mirror outage — check the job's auth error code before paging anyone else. Rotations happen monthly. For manual retries against the mirror, authenticate with the bearer token below.

session JWT of yawep-yawep = eyJhbGciOiJIUzI1NiIsInR5cCI6IkpXVCJ9.eyJzdWIiOiI3pWF3_In0.aXYsHiog

Subject: Handover — Diffgale release duties

Hi all — I'm passing Diffgale release management to Perrin next sprint. Plugin authors: nothing changes for you except the signature on large-file diff bundles, which rotates with the handover. Keep chunked rendering tests green before tagging, as always. For verifying releases signed after Friday, use the key below.

release key, yagap-kagag: bky6_1ks93y